Elevance Health Director Robert L. Dixon Jr. Receives Award
What Happened Robert L. Dixon Jr., a director of Elevance Health, Inc. (ELV), was granted 563 deferred stock units on May 13, 2026. The units were awarded at $0.00 per unit (total reported value $0) as part of the Company's Board of Directors compensation program. This was an award/grant (code A), not an open-market purchase or sale.
Key Details
- Transaction date: 2026-05-13; transaction type: Grant/Award (A); amount: 563 units; price: $0.00.
- Filing: Form 4 filed 2026-05-15 for the 2026-05-13 grant — appears to be timely (filed within the usual two-business-day window).
- Shares owned after transaction: not disclosed in this filing.
- Footnotes: (F1) Units are deferred stock units under the Board compensation program. (F2) Units will be payable in Company common stock upon the earlier of (a) five years from grant or (b) the director’s departure from the board, unless a different date was elected under the Deferred Compensation Plan.
Context Deferred stock unit awards to directors are a routine form of non-cash compensation that convert into company shares at a future date or upon exit from board service. Such grants align director pay with shareholder interests but do not involve an immediate cash purchase or sale and do not by themselves indicate the director’s private trading sentiment.
